Business Configuration Analyst - Health Alliance Plan
E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E REQUIRED:
-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science or Business Administration.
- Related and relevant experience may be considered in lieu of academic requirements. Related experience is defined as six (6) years’ experience in Health Care related business and/or claims processing system configuration
- Two (2) years of claims processing system configuration experience or demonstrated proficiency through relevant HAP specific business experience.
Benefits Configuration
Additional preferred requirements
⦁ Interpret Member and Group contracts for Benefit configuration.
⦁ Experience developing Service IDs, Supplemental Mapping, Service Rules, Variable Components, Product Component Configuration
⦁ Knowledge of Claims Processing on Facets with ability to troubleshoot
Provider Configuration
Additional preferred requirements
⦁ Experience with Facets Provider Structure including Network Sets, NWPR and NPPR functionality
⦁ Knowledge of Claims Processing on Facets with ability to troubleshoot
Pricing Configuration
Additional preferred requirements
⦁ Experience with Facets NetworX Agreement Configuration
⦁ Experience with Medicare PPS Pricing Methodology
⦁ Experience with configuring Optum PPS Modules to work in a Facets environment
⦁ Knowledge of Claims Processing on Facets with ability to troubleshoot
Technical Configuration
Additional preferred requirements
⦁ Knowledge of Facets 5.74 group structure and claims processing fundamentals is required
⦁ Skilled in SQL, PL/SQL Programming under Oracle 11g and Unix Korn Shell scripting
⦁ Knowledge of Cognos
⦁ Knowledge of business principles and functions
⦁ Knowledge of Windows, Microsoft Excel and Word, Client Server Applications, Client Server Data Base Structure, Project Management Tools, Implementation /Administration of Packaged Applications and SQL Developer.
⦁ Knowledge of Facets Configuration Migration Utility (CMU) and Facets Security Management Tool (SMT)
SKILLS AND ABILITIES:
- Demonstrated ability to research, analyze, design, plan, organize, coordinate, implement, and perform necessary follow-up and closure procedures for system related projects.
- Understanding of healthcare industry and managed care concepts.
- Knowledge of a table driven claims processing system.
- Knowledge of Windows, Microsoft Excel and Word, Query Tools (COGNOS, etc.) and Implementation/Administration of Packaged Claims Processing Applications.
